Gonzalo joined Telefónica in 1997, when he started working in the legal department of Telefónica International, the entity that managed Telefónica´s international operations at that time. In 1999 he was appointed as Legal Manager of Telefónica Móviles, the holding company that managed all the mobile operations worldwide.

In 2002 he was appointed Legal Director of Telefónica Móviles México, where he worked for almost three years before returning to Spain to join Telefónica Latino américa.

In October 2006 he was designated as Director of the Secretaría General Técnica (Chairman´s Office) of Telefónica Latino américa, where he has been working until the beginning of 2011, when he was appointed as Wayra’s Global Leader.

Wayra is part of Telefónica’s new Digital unit and aims to become the largest technology accelerator on earth. Launched last year in Latin America and Spain, Wayra was created to find and nurture the best technology ideas and talent, aiming to become an accelerator for the development of future ‘Silicon Valleys’ in the countries where Telefónica is present.

Wayra is aimed at early stage technology start-ups and is open to entrepreneurs of all ICT backgrounds. In addition to financing, the 10 projects, selected during a Wayra, will also receive integral support from Telefónica, mentoring, access to technology expertise at Telefónica and use of a special co-working space, the Wayra Academies and all the tools necessary to create successful business.

As per today, Wayra has presence in Colombia, México, Spain (Madrid and Barcelona), Venezuela, Perú, Argentina, Brazil, Chile and UK. In 2012 Wayra will launch operations in Germany, Ireland and Czech Republic.

Gonzalo has a degree in Law (1990-1995) by the Universidad Complutense de Madrid, an LLM by Georgetown University (1996-1997), and also holds an MBA from IESE Business School - University of Navarra (2005–2007).
